CompoundAce Members

Represents a compound Access Control Entry (ACE).

The following tables list the members exposed by the CompoundAce type.

  Name Description
Public method CompoundAce Initializes a new instance of the CompoundAce class.
Top

  Name Description
Public property AccessMask  Gets or sets the access mask for this KnownAce object.(Inherited from KnownAce.)
Public property AceFlags  Gets or sets the AceFlags associated with this GenericAce object.(Inherited from GenericAce.)
Public property AceType  Gets the type of this Access Control Entry (ACE).(Inherited from GenericAce.)
Public property AuditFlags  Gets the audit information associated with this Access Control Entry (ACE).(Inherited from GenericAce.)
Public property BinaryLength Overridden. Gets the length, in bytes, of the binary representation of the current CompoundAce object. This length should be used before marshaling the ACL into a binary array with the GetBinaryForm method.
Public property CompoundAceType Gets or sets the type of this CompoundAce object.
Public property InheritanceFlags  Gets flags that specify the inheritance properties of this Access Control Entry (ACE).(Inherited from GenericAce.)
Public property IsInherited  Gets a Boolean value that specifies whether this Access Control Entry (ACE) is inherited or is set explicitly.(Inherited from GenericAce.)
Public property PropagationFlags  Gets flags that specify the inheritance propagation properties of this Access Control Entry (ACE).(Inherited from GenericAce.)
Public property SecurityIdentifier  Gets or sets the SecurityIdentifier object associated with this KnownAce object.(Inherited from KnownAce.)
Top

  Name Description
Public method Copy  Creates a deep copy of this Access Control Entry (ACE). (Inherited from GenericAce.)
Public method Static CreateFromBinaryForm  Creates a GenericAce object from the specified binary data. (Inherited from GenericAce.)
Public method Equals  Overloaded. (Inherited from GenericAce.)
Public method GetBinaryForm Overridden. Marshals the contents of the CompoundAce object into the specified byte array beginning at the specified offset.
Public method GetHashCode  Serves as a hash function for the GenericAce class. The GetHashCode method is suitable for use in hashing algorithms and data structures like a hash table. (Inherited from GenericAce.)
Public method GetType  Gets the Type of the current instance. (Inherited from Object.)
Public method Static op_Equality  Determines whether the specified GenericAce objects are considered equal. (Inherited from GenericAce.)
Public method Static op_Inequality  Determines whether the specified GenericAce objects are considered unequal. (Inherited from GenericAce.)
Public method Static ReferenceEquals  Determines whether the specified Object instances are the same instance. (Inherited from Object.)
Public method ToString  Returns a String that represents the current Object. (Inherited from Object.)
Top

Community Additions

ADD
Show: